Excelsior Radio
Excelsior is an internet only radio station located in Salisbury MD focusing on balancing life with different kind of musics, shows, podcast to match people's
Excelsior is an internet only radio station located in Salisbury MD focusing on balancing life with different kind of musics, shows, podcast to match people's